Tips for Optimal RC Car Speed

Keeping your RC car in tip-top shape is crucial for a seamless run. It's not just about the power; it's also about longevity. To keep your ride functioning at its best, follow these upkeep tips:

* Regularly check your car for any damage. Look thoroughly at the chassis, wheels, tires, and electronics.

* Keep your motors lubricated to decrease friction and enhance their lifespan.

* Clean your car after each use to get rid of dirt, dust, and debris. This will avoid corrosion and maintain its appearance.

* Check your battery capacity regularly and recharge it when needed. Avoid overcharging to enhance its longevity.
